Kalamazoo hospital leader to resign at end of year
September 17th, 2004
Randall Stasik, president and chief executive of Borgess Health Alliance, plans to resign at the end of the year, the company said. Stasik, 53, who joined Borgess in 1988 and has been president and CEO since February 1, 2001, said he will remain in the post through the end of the year to help with a smooth transition to new leadership. "It was a very difficult decision for me," Stasik said August 25, 2004, when contacted by the Kalamazoo Gazette. "But I feel it's best for me and my family." He said he had no immediate plans after he resigns other than to look for another position "in or out of healthcare." ...
